Buildern is the #1 Construction Management Platform that helps residential and commercial builders manage projects from estimating to financials in one place. Our platform gives construction teams the tools they need to plan, collaborate, and deliver projects with confidence.


We’re looking for an experienced Business Analyst to help transform business needs into clear, detailed, and implementation-ready requirements. You’ll work closely with Product Managers, Engineering, Design, QA, Customer Success, Sales, and customers to ensure business problems are fully understood, solutions are well designed, and engineering teams have everything they need to deliver high-quality software.


This is not a documentation-only role. You’ll help shape solutions, challenge assumptions, think through complex business scenarios, identify edge cases, and ensure every feature is fully defined before development begins.


What You’ll Do

Requirements & Analysis

  • Gather and analyze business requirements from Product, Customer Success, Sales, Support, and other stakeholders.
  • Conduct customer interviews and discovery sessions to understand business processes, workflows, pain points, and opportunities.
  • Analyze existing workflows and identify opportunities to improve efficiency, usability, and customer experience.
  • Research competitor products and industry best practices to help shape product improvements.
  • Challenge assumptions and recommend simpler, more effective solutions where appropriate.


Product Delivery

  • Own the quality and completeness of business requirements, ensuring engineering teams receive implementation-ready specifications before development begins.
  • Translate business needs into detailed functional requirements, user stories, business rules, workflows, acceptance criteria, and functional specifications.
  • Document current and future-state business processes using diagrams, process flows, and supporting documentation.
  • Identify risks, dependencies, edge cases, exceptions, and process gaps early in the planning process.
  • Lead backlog refinement for assigned initiatives and ensure stories are ready before sprint planning.
  • Collaborate closely with Product Managers, Engineering, Design, and QA throughout the software development lifecycle.
  • Clarify requirements during implementation and help resolve functional questions raised by engineering.
  • Validate completed features to ensure they solve the original business problem and meet documented requirements before release.
